For me it comes down to just 3 companies:

Atari, Sega and Taito - through the 80s and 90s they released more classic games than anyone and continued to come up with more new ideas and technical advancements.

I went with Atari in the end because not only did they create the whole arcade industry but also innovated more than anyone else time and time again from the early days with stuff like Breakout, Tempest and Missile Command right through to games like STUN Runner, Hard Drivin' and A.P.B.

Looking down that list of companies, an impressive list indeed(!), it is so hard to choose just one!  Each has given us seriously epic pieces of gaming history. 

I've already nearly chosen Atari thanks to Star Wars, Gauntlet, Super Sprint and I-Robot - one of my favourite arcade games.  Capcom - Commando, 1942, Ghosts n' Goblins, Sidearms, Strider.  Namco for another of my favs, Rolling Thunder.  And then there's Dig Dug & Rally-X... man!  I'm having nostalgia overload!!

After all that though my vote's going to Konami.  Track & Field and Hyper Sports created such a spirit of competition when played with mates and were still brilliant fun in single player.  Shao-Lin's Road is equally one of my favourite arcade games along with Amidar.  So, Konami, I salute you.
